IFT 2012
Date
25 June - 28 June
Organizer
Institute of Food Technologists
Website
Industry news
Category news
Multimedia
Suppliers
Industry news
Category news
Multimedia
Suppliers
IFT 2012
Date
25 June - 28 June
Organizer
Institute of Food Technologists
Website